WebChildhood SDB is a spectrum of abnormal breathing patterns during sleep that ranges from primary snoring to OSA. OSA in children is an SDB characterized by prolonged partial upper airway obstruction and/or intermittent complete obstruction that affects normal ventilation during sleep. 46 OSA is considered the most severe disease within the spectrum of SDB. WebApnea(呼吸暂停) Cessation(暂停) of breathing Voluntary breath- holding;depression of CNS control centers. Normal Ventilation Values in Pulmonary Medicine. Total pulmonary ventilation 6 L/min Total alveolar ventilation 4 L/min. Maximum voluntary ventilation 125-170 L/min Respiration rate 12-20 breaths/min.
